THE new R15-million road connecting Mondi to the Richards Bay CBD via Alton will open ‘any day now’.
Named ‘Kraft Link’, the road is a special bonus for Mondi employees who can literally leave the company’s gates and join the flow of traffic at the Ceramic Curve intersection opposite the landfill site.
At present, employees have an agonising wait at the Mondi robots on the John Ross Highway.
‘I suspect those going to Empangeni might even find it quicker and less stressful to take the new road, turn right at the landfill site and right again at the John Ross Highway,’ said Deputy City Engineer - Bert Kirsten.
He said that final power supplies and robot connections were all that were needed before the road is officially opened ‘within a week or so’.
